【技术实现步骤摘要】
一种MPLS网络检测的实现方法、装置、网络设备和控制器
本专利技术实施例涉及但不限于一种MPLS((Multi-ProtocolLabelSwitching,多协议标签交换)网络检测的实现方法、装置、网络设备、控制器和计算机可读存储介质。
技术介绍
IP(InternetProtocol,网际互联协议)/MPLS是一种层网络模型,简单来看可以分为业务(L3VPN(Layer3VirtualPrivateNetworks,三层虚拟私有网络)等)和管道(隧道、LSP(LabelSwitchingPath,标记交换路径)等)两个层次,针对不同的层次对象的性能检测,采用的检测方法也是不同的。如管道的检测一般通过RFC6374或G.8113.1定义的LM(LossMeasure,损失测量)和DM(DelayMeasure,延迟测量)功能来实现,业务这个层次的检测可以通过TWAMP(Two-WayActiveMeasurementProtocol,双向主动测量协议)来实现。针对不同检测对象,目前检测机制的标识的方法也不相同。例如,对于隧道,一般通过MPLS标签来标识需要统计的 ...
【技术保护点】
1.一种多协议标签交换MPLS网络检测的实现方法,包括:检测域中的节点确定检测对象的信息和检测任务,其中,所述检测对象的信息包括对象标识;所述节点为所述检测域的头节点时,在接收到的业务流中识别出与所述检测对象匹配的业务报文,在所述业务报文的MPLS标签中加入所述对象标识,转发包含所述对象标识的业务报文;所述节点为所述检测域的头节点、或中间节点、或尾节点时,按照所述检测任务,对包含所述对象标识的业务报文执行检测操作。
【技术特征摘要】
1.一种多协议标签交换MPLS网络检测的实现方法,包括:检测域中的节点确定检测对象的信息和检测任务,其中,所述检测对象的信息包括对象标识;所述节点为所述检测域的头节点时,在接收到的业务流中识别出与所述检测对象匹配的业务报文,在所述业务报文的MPLS标签中加入所述对象标识,转发包含所述对象标识的业务报文;所述节点为所述检测域的头节点、或中间节点、或尾节点时,按照所述检测任务,对包含所述对象标识的业务报文执行检测操作。2.如权利要求1所述的方法,其特征在于,所述检测对象包括如下至少之一:隧道、业务流、伪线PW。3.如权利要求2所述的方法,其特征在于,所述在接收到的业务流中识别出与所述检测对象匹配的业务报文包括如下至少之一:所述检测对象包括隧道时,所述检测对象的信息还包括隧道标识,所述头节点根据所述隧道标识在接收到的业务流中识别出与所述检测对象匹配的业务报文;所述检测对象包括业务流时,所述检测对象的信息还包括业务流的特征信息,所述头节点根据所述业务流的特征信息在接收到的业务流中识别出与所述检测对象匹配的业务报文;所述检测对象包括PW时,所述检测对象的信息还包括PW标识,所述头节点根据所述PW标识在接收到的业务流中识别出与所述检测对象匹配的业务报文。4.如权利要求1所述的方法,其特征在于,通过节点标识和对象标识的二元组的方式标识所述检测对象,所述检测域中的节点确定检测对象的信息和检测任务,包括:所述检测域中的头节点分配所述对象标识。5.如权利要求1所述的方法,其特征在于,通过节点标识和对象标识的二元组的方式标识所述检测对象,所述在所述业务报文的MPLS标签中加入所述对象标识,转发包含所述对象标识的业务报文,包括:在所述业务报文的MPLS标签中加入头节点标识和对象标识的二元组,转发包含所述二元组的业务报文。6.如权利要求1所述的方法,其特征在于,所述在所述业务报文的MPLS标签中加入所述对象标识,包括:根据所述检测对象确定所述对象标识在所述MPLS标签中的位置,按照所述位置,在所述MPLS标签中加入所述对象标识。7.如权利要求1所述的方法,其特征在于,所述在所述业务报文的MPLS标签中加入所述对象标识,包括:在所述MPLS标签中加入预设的引导标签和所述对象标识,所述引导标签位于所述对象标识之前,用于指示所述对象标识在所述MPLS标签的位置。8.如权利要求7所述的方法,其特征在于,所述预设的引导标签包括如下至少之一:特殊用途标签;扩展标签和扩展特殊用途标签的组合。9.如权利要求1所述的方法,其特征在于,所述对象标识中包含标记域,所述在所述业务报文的MPLS标签中加入所述对象标识,包括:按照预设的标记规则设置所述标记域,在所述MPLS标签中加入包含所述标记域的对象标识。10.如权利要求9所述的方法,其特征在于,所述述检测任务包括主动双向检测TWAMP报文测量,所述在接收到的业务流中识别出与所述检测对象匹配的业务报文之后,还包括:在所述业务流中插入TWAMP报文,所述TWAMP报文的MPLS标签中携带包含所述标记域的对象标识,通过所述标记域指示报文类型为TWAMP报文。11.如权利要求10所述的方法,其特征在于,所述节点按照所述检测任务,对包含所述对象标识的业务报文执行检测操作包括:所述节点为所述检测域的头节点时,对发出的所述业务报文进行计数统计,将计数统计的值携带在所述TWAMP报文中发送出去;所述节点为所述检测域的尾节点时,对接收到的所述业务报文进行计数统计,将接收到的所述TWAMP报文中携带的计数统计的值与自身计数统计的值进行比较,得到TWAMP测量结果。12.如权利要求9所述的方法,其特征在于,所述检测任务包括:进行带内的性能统计,所述标记域包括交替着色标记,所述节点按照所述检测任务,对包含所述对象标识的业务报文执行检测操作包括:所述节点为所述检测域的头节点时,按照所述交替着色标记的信息,对发出的所述业务报文进行计数统计;所述节点为所述检测域的中间节点时,按照所述交替着色标记的信息,对接收到的和发出的所述业务报文进行计数统计;所述节点为所述检测域的尾节点时,按照所述交替着色标记的信息,对接收到的所述业务报文进行计数统计。13.如权利要求9所述的方法,其特征在于,所述检测任务包括:进行带内的性能统计,所述标记域包括时延测量标记,所述节点按照所述检测任务,对包含所述对象标识的业务报文执行检测操作包括:所述节点为所述检测域的头节点时,按照所述时延测量标记的信息对所述业务报文进行时戳标记,记录所述业务报文发送时的时戳;所述节点为所述检测域的中间节点时,按照所述时延测量标记的信息对所述业务报文进行时戳标记,记录所述业务报文到达时和发送时的时戳;所述节点为所述检测域的尾节点时,按照所述时延测量标记的信息对所述业务报文进行时戳标记,记录所述业务报文到达时的时戳。14.如权利要求1所述的方法,其特征在于,所述检测任务包括:对业...
【专利技术属性】
技术研发人员:詹双平,柯明,
申请(专利权)人:中兴通讯股份有限公司,
类型:发明
国别省市:广东,44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。